当前位置:主页 > 管理论文 > 移动网络论文 >

NFV中服务功能链的故障诊断方法

发布时间:2020-07-09 17:54
【摘要】:网络功能虚拟化(Network Function Virtualization,NFV)作为解决电信运营商网络资源利用率低,部署业务不够灵活的新技术,受到了业界的广泛关注和研究。NFV以软件的方式实现了网络中的部分服务功能,达到了网络中服务功能与底层硬件资源的解耦,以及在通用的硬件平台上灵活部署服务功能的目的。NFV给当前网络带来便利的同时,由于服务功能与底层资源之间对应关系的不确定性、底层资源动态分配等因素,导致当前网络的故障定位面临新的挑战。服务功能链是由网络中的服务功能按照一定的顺序连接起来组成的。NFV网络环境下,与服务功能直接相连的节点被称为服务功能转发节点,转发节点之间相互连接实现服务功能之间的通信。因此NFV网络环境中服务功能链的故障诊断,也就是定位可能发生故障的服务功能、服务功能转发节点和节点之间的链路。故障诊断分为两个阶段:故障探测阶段和故障定位阶段。故障探测阶段的主要研究是如何利用最小的网络探测开销,快速的探测到网络中可能存在故障的服务功能链。故障定位阶段的目的是如何根据探测阶段有限的故障探测结果,精确地定位故障发生的根源。综上所述,主要的研究内容包括:(1)提出一种最小流的主动探测方法。该方法的目标是在故障探测阶段,以最小的网络探测开销,快速地定位哪些探测路径上发生了故障。该方法首先根据当前网络中服务功能的连接关系寻找探测站点,并以该探测站点为起点计算探测路径。探测路径集合能够覆盖服务功能链中的所有服务功能和虚拟链路,而且探测路径之间的虚拟链路不重复,按照计算的探测路径主动发送探测包,便实现了以最小的探测开销快速定位哪条链路发生故障。(2)提出一种分层以及分类的故障定位算法。依据NFV网络结构特点,将服务功能链分为服务功能层和服务功能转发层。依据故障症状的不同,将NFV网络中的故障分为服务可用性故障和服务质量劣化故障。首先,本文在服务功能层分别定位可能发生两类故障的服务功能和连接服务功能的虚拟链路,然后根据服务功能层和服务功能转发层之间的对应关系,将服务功能层可能故障的节点和虚拟链路映射到服务功能转发层;最后根据节点和链路的故障概率定位两类故障的根源。针对NFV场景下较为突出的服务质量劣化故障,本文参考IETF规范设计网络服务包头字段,实现在服务功能层精确定位质量劣化故障的位置。
【学位授予单位】:北京邮电大学
【学位级别】:硕士
【学位授予年份】:2018
【分类号】:TP393.0
【图文】:

功能图,虚拟网络,功能,分支结构


|物理网络元素逦侧链路y,物理网络端口逡逑图2-2虚拟网络功能转发图逡逑图2.2呈现的是一条线性的单向的服务功能链的物理视图,但真正网络中的逡逑服务功能链可能是有分支结构而且可能是双向的。图2.3中展示了网络中3种不逡逑同类型的单向服务功能链,该图中仅表示服务功能之间的连接关系,并没有具体逡逑展示与服务功能相连的交换机。其中,SFQ有分支结构并且起点相同而终点不逡逑同,SFC2有分支结构且由同一起点出发并终止于同一终点,而SFC3没有分支结逡逑构。逡逑-^/sF4)逦^SF^)逡逑SFC:"邋?—O—#担蓿埃]3?W邋逦{sF^逦逡逑图2.3服务功能链逡逑2.2服务功能链中故障诊断相关概念逡逑10逡逑

模型图,模型,功能链,虚拟链


逦北京邮电大学工学硕士学位论文逦逡逑SF4同样在收到探测包后,将自己的标识字段加入探测包头中,并分别发送给服逡逑务功能链的起始服务功能和终止服务功能。由上可知,探测服务功能链探测包逡逑SFC1被转发的次数为16次。按照服务功能链发送探测探测包,则探测服务功能逡逑链SFC1需要分别从SF1向SF6和SF9发送探测包,探测包被转发的次数为7逡逑次,其中SF1到SF2以及SF2到SF3之间的链路被探测了两次;而且在探测服逡逑务功能链SFC2时,SF4到SF6的虚拟链路也被重复探测了,同样在探测SFC3逡逑时,SF3到SF9之间的虚拟链路也被重复探测了,这都会造成额外的网络带宽和逡逑计算资源的消耗。逡逑

对比图,探测站,链条,评估指标


逦(B)逡逑图3-5不同服务功能链条数下三种算法评估指标对比图逡逑从图3-5的(A)图中可以看出,随着服务功能链条数的增加,FMM、PLM逡逑和本文提出的FDM方法部署的探测站点的数目都逐渐增加。FMM和PLM方逡逑法由于都是将服务功能链的首个服务功能部署为探测站点,故二者部署探测站点逡逑数目相同,探测站点的数目不超过服务功能链的条数;而本文提出的方法计算的逡逑探测路径为服务功能链的子集,因此故障探测站点的数目略多于现有的两种方法,逡逑但是随着服务功能链条数的增加,两者之间的差距也在逐渐缩小,因为随着服务逡逑功能链条数的增加,服务功能链间共用的虚拟链路也会增多,因此再部署新的服逡逑务功能链时,可能已有的探测站点就能够完全探测该条服务功能链。逡逑主动探测的开销主要是探测包对网络上链路带宽的占用,因此本文以一次完逡逑整的网络故障探测中探测包被转发的次数来代指主动探测的开销。从图3-5的(B)逡逑图中可以看出

【相似文献】

相关期刊论文 前10条

1 王芳,徐理;基于功能链的供应链与价值链之内在联系[J];价值工程;2004年06期

2 石福丽;朱一凡;;基于信息功能链的军事通信网络拓扑抗毁性评估方法[J];装备指挥技术学院学报;2011年06期

3 张惠英;;从“个、底”功能链接说起[J];语文研究;2010年01期

4 戴华英;300吨/小时多功能链斗式挖砂船[J];水运科技信息;1994年06期

5 张传浩;周桥;;节点效用最大化的服务功能链构建方法[J];计算机应用;2018年02期

6 ;成就中国首个IP智能边缘服务功能链[J];个人电脑;2015年04期

7 梁琼瑶;秦华;刘文懋;;基于软件定义安全的服务功能链设计[J];计算机系统应用;2018年08期

8 刘艺;张红旗;杨英杰;常德显;;一种区分等级的可生存服务功能链映射方法[J];计算机研究与发展;2018年04期

9 王琛;汤红波;游伟;袁泉;牛r

本文编号:2747796


资料下载
论文发表

本文链接:https://www.wllwen.com/guanlilunwen/ydhl/2747796.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户2acb1***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com